在C语言中,可以通过以下方法定义一个空数组: 使用指针定义空数组:可以声明一个指针变量,并将其初始化为NULL,表示该指针指向一个空数组。 int *arr = NULL; 复制代码 使用静态数组定义空数组:可以声明一个静态数组,并将其长度设置为0,表示该数组为空数组。 int arr[0]; 复制代码 需要注意的是,定义空数组并不...
在C语言中,我们可以使用方括号[]和索引来访问和操作数组元素,要访问上面定义的myArray数组的第一个元素,可以使用以下代码: int firstElement = myArray[0]; 同样,我们可以使用索引来修改数组元素的值,要将myArray数组的第一个元素设置为10,可以使用以下代码: myArray[0] = 10; 5、遍历数组 为了遍历数组中的...
因为定义一个数组后,不初始化,数组的值就是当前内存区域的值,这个值是不确定的(通常未初始化的内存区域的16进制数值为0xcc)如果要定义一个全0的数组可以 int TCi[W]={0};int TCo[W]={0};这样会自动将数组区域清空为0(只要定义数组时为数组赋值,则会将该数组其余未赋值的空间自动赋值为0)
按你的定义应该是默认数组长度为1 笑看风云time 异能力者 6 proud的C语言 彩虹面包 13 你们知道TFBOY有多努力吗,TFBOY发烧62度为了众多粉丝的等待还坚持上台唱歌,双腿粉碎性骨折还坚持练习踢踏舞,每日练舞40个小时以上,拥有全世界300亿粉丝却从不骄傲,成员精通韩国和朝0鲜两国语言,每年的2月30日还举行慈善...